Port Forwarding, Pinhole conflict detected

Hi so recently I restarted my router by holding down the restart button for 16 seconds and I had a minecraft server port forwarded and when I tried to open it my friends couldn't connect to it so I thought that it wasen't forwarded and I was right so I tried to port forward the server again and when I chose my computer as a host device it fives me a "Pinhole Conflict Detected XXX" error. Hi @Cyberbunny786,

 

There may be a port forwarding option that encompasses the port you are trying to use, such as if you use DMZ/passthrough mode. If you are not too sure where it is, try resetting the gateway and setting up the port forwarding options again.
